Skip to content

Introduction to Field Service Extensions (Sample)

Field Service Extensions (Sample) enhances Salesforce Field Service by adding capabilities designed to improve technician safety, support mobile productivity, and increase dispatcher visibility.

This managed package provides ready-to-configure features that integrate with an existing Field Service implementation, allowing administrators to enable functionality based on organizational needs.

Current Features

The current release includes the following features:

  • Working Alone Timer and Alert System
    Monitor lone worker status and receive alerts when safety timers expire.
  • Mobile Layout
    Apply mobile-specific layout configurations to improve technician user experience.
  • Mass Recurring Non-Availabilities
    Schedule large-scale or recurring resource unavailability events.
  • Timesheets Management App
    Enable resource timesheet tracking, review, and approvals.
  • Union Rules
    Automatically categorize logged time based on configurable business rules (e.g., Regular, Overtime, Holiday).

Pre-Installation Requirements

Before installing the package, ensure the following prerequisites are met:

Assign Field Service Permission Sets

Ensure users are assigned the appropriate Field Service Permission Set Licenses and Permission Sets, as outlined below.

User Permission Set License Permission Sets
Dispatcher
  • Field Service Dispatcher
  • Field Service Dispatcher Permissions
  • Field Service Dispatcher License
Technician
  • Field Service Mobile
  • Field Service Scheduling
    • Field Service Resource License
    • Field Service Resource Permissions
    • Field Service Mobile License

    Refer to Salesforce Help documentation for detailed guidance:

    Install the Package

    To install Field Service Extensions (Sample):

    1. Open the installation link provided for your implementation.
    2. Log in to the Salesforce org where the package will be installed.
    3. Enter the installation password (if required), select Install for Admin Users Only, and click Install.

      Installation may take several minutes. You will receive an email notification when the process completes.

    4. After installation, go to Setup and confirm the package appears under Installed Packages.

    Once installation is complete, proceed to the feature-specific configuration sections.

    Note: Available features may vary by implementation. Not all features described in this guide may be enabled in every org.

    Assign Package Licenses

    This package uses Salesforce licensing. After installation, assign a license to each user who requires access, including System Administrators, Dispatchers, and Mobile Technicians.

    To assign package licenses:

    1. From Setup, enter Installed Packages in the Quick Find box and select Installed Packages.
    2. Click Manage Licenses next to Field Service Extensions (Sample).
    3. On the Package Manager page, click Add Users.
    4. Select the users who require access.
    5. Click Add.

    Note: Users without an assigned license will not be able to access package functionality, including administrative configuration.